首页 > 精选知识 >

jsp入门教程

2025-06-21 10:23:14

问题描述:

jsp入门教程,急!这个问题想破头了,求解答!

最佳答案

推荐答案

2025-06-21 10:23:14
JSP入门教程 在现代Web开发中,JavaServer Pages(简称JSP)是一种非常重要的技术。它允许开发者通过嵌入Java代码来动态生成HTML页面。JSP为构建动态网站提供了强大的支持,尤其是在企业级应用中,其稳定性和可扩展性使其成为首选方案之一。 什么是JSP? JSP是Java平台的一部分,用于创建动态网页内容。它基于Servlet技术,但与传统的Servlet相比,JSP更直观和易于使用。通过将HTML标记和Java代码结合在一起,JSP简化了动态网页的开发过程。 JSP的工作原理 当用户请求一个JSP页面时,服务器会首先将JSP文件转换成一个Servlet类。然后,这个Servlet会被编译并执行,最终生成响应发送给客户端。这种机制使得JSP能够高效地处理复杂的业务逻辑,同时保持界面的灵活性。 JSP的基本结构 一个典型的JSP文件通常包含以下三个部分: 1. 声明区:用于定义变量或方法。 2. 脚本区:包含Java代码片段,可以直接嵌入到页面中。 3. 表达式区:用于输出数据到页面上。 例如: ```jsp <%! int counter = 0; %> <% counter++; %> ``` 在这个例子中,`<%! ... %>`定义了一个全局变量`counter`,而`<% ... %>`则包含了实际的逻辑代码,最后通过`<%= ... %>`将结果输出到页面。 如何开始学习JSP? 对于初学者来说,掌握JSP的第一步是熟悉HTML和基本的Java编程知识。接下来,你可以尝试搭建一个简单的开发环境,比如安装Apache Tomcat作为服务器,并使用Eclipse等IDE进行编码。 实践项目 为了更好地理解JSP,建议从一个小项目开始实践。例如,可以尝试创建一个简单的博客系统,其中用户可以通过表单提交文章,后台使用JSP处理这些请求并存储数据。 总结 JSP是一个功能强大且灵活的技术,适合那些希望快速构建动态网站的开发者。通过学习和实践,你将能够熟练运用JSP来解决实际问题。希望这篇简短的介绍能为你打开一扇通往JSP世界的大门!

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。